SNORING

My teenage daughter told me today that I was snoring so loud she could hear me. Her bedroom is 30 feet away from mine. We both had our doors shut also. I had trouble sleeping since I was a non~overweight kid, which I am sure was stress related. During the non overweight times I am sure I did not snore.

I have some sleep apnea...blah blah blah.

How have you "snore people" been doing after your weight loss? Has it lessened or disappeared?

Oh, please tell me it improved or disappeared. :-)

THANKS

My husband used to snore so loud it could wake the neighbors! jk We didn't even sleep in the same room because of his snoring! It's been a year since his surgery and he does not snore at all anymore. Nothing ever! It has been truly amazing! I have always been the light sleeper and wasn't able to sleep with him even though I snored, too. Now he wakes me up when I snore!!! So there is hope. Good luck!

I am 9 days PO. I can not believe it...NO snoring. I used to wake myself up with it. I also no longer have the constant cough from the gerd trouble I HAD. This all must have been related somehow. Plus the obvious of no caffene and other food that caused symptoms

I have only lost 10#, I expected having to lose 50# before I saw a difference.

Even if I lose 1/2 of my 80#, I am so happy to have the cough and snoring gone.
